Applications

There is no other company in the world today that offers the experience and expertise you will find at YORK Navy Systems. Over 90% of vessels in the U.S. Navy fleet, surface ships as well as submarines, utilize YORK air conditioning and refrigeration equipment. Additionally, YORK has equipment in service with over 19 of the world’s navies and has supplied air conditioning and refrigeration plants to over 1300 fighting ships including a majority of the NATO fleet. YORK, through its own manufacturing facilities, has provided CFC-free reciprocating, centrifugal, screw, and rotary compressor equipment to world navies for vessels of all types.

Research and Development

YORK has ongoing technology design and insertion projects with the US and NATO Navies among others. These projects include developing the absolute latest technology compressors, heat exchangers, and control systems to meet the demands of the modern Navies. Technologies such as magnetic bearings, condition-based maintenance, and variable speed drive not only provide more reliable technologies but when factored into the total ownership cost, provide a much more attractive through life offering. Likewise, these reliabilities allow for a lower requirement of human effort in the maintenance of the system and therefore improve the shipboard quality of life.

Dependability

For over 90 years, YORK has satisfied the uncompromising demands of the world’s navies for quality control and dependability throughout our broad range of engineered components and systems. Our naval equipment is designed and tested to meet the stringent requirements for survivability, efficiency, and low noise signature demanded by modern warship technology. Furthermore, integrated logistic support (ILS) principles are applied to YORK Navy products such that equipment reliability, supportability, and maintainability are assured.
